Understanding the Equine Respiratory System

The equine respiratory system plays a pivotal role in sustaining the optimal health and functionality of horses. Similar to humans, horses rely on efficient respiration to supply oxygen to their bodies and remove carbon dioxide, a byproduct of cellular metabolism.

Proper lung function is critical for horses, especially those engaged in high-performance activities such as racing, show jumping, or endurance riding. Any compromise in their respiratory health can significantly affect their performance and well-being.

The Significance of Oxygen for Horses

Oxygen is a vital component that fuels the metabolic processes within a horse's body. Adequate oxygen intake is essential for cellular respiration, energy production, and overall physiological functions. Horses require a constant and sufficient supply of oxygen to support their daily activities, ranging from grazing in the pasture to participating in competitive events.

Optimizing the delivery of oxygen to the horse's tissues and organs is crucial for ensuring peak performance and preventing respiratory-related issues. Exploring Equine Pharmacy Solutions for Respiratory Health

Equine pharmacies offer a wide range of products specifically designed to promote respiratory health in horses. From bronchodilators to anti-inflammatory medications, these pharmacy solutions can help manage respiratory conditions and improve lung function.

By working closely with professionals in the field of equine medicine, horse owners can access specialized medications and treatments tailored to address various respiratory issues, such as allergies, infections, or exercise-induced asthma.

The Role of Horse Supplements in Supporting Respiratory Function

In addition to pharmaceutical interventions, horse supplements play a complementary role in enhancing respiratory function and oxygen utilization. Certain supplements contain potent ingredients known to support lung health, reduce inflammation, and boost immune response in horses.

Commonly used supplements like omega-3 fatty acids, antioxidants, and herbal blends can aid in maintaining respiratory integrity, reducing oxidative stress, and improving overall lung capacity in horses. When incorporated into a well-balanced diet, these supplements can contribute to optimizing equine respiratory health.

Optimizing Respiratory Health with Proper Medication Protocols

For horses with specific respiratory conditions or performance-related challenges, targeted medications prescribed by equine veterinarians can make a significant difference in their well-being. Medications such as bronchodilators, corticosteroids, or antihistamines can help manage symptoms and improve lung function.

It is essential for horse owners to follow the recommended medication protocols, dosage instructions, and monitoring guidelines provided by veterinary professionals. Consistent veterinary care and collaboration with equine pharmacy experts can ensure that horses receive the necessary treatments to maintain their respiratory health.
